The Economic Shift: AI Video Generation vs. Traditional Production
In the rapidly evolving landscape of digital media, the debate between utilizing Artificial Intelligence (AI) for video creation and adhering to traditional production methods has moved from theoretical to financial. As of 2026, generative video models like Sora, Veo, and Kling have matured, offering high-fidelity outputs that challenge the necessity of physical film sets for certain use cases. However, understanding the cost-benefit ratio requires a deep dive into the underlying logistics of both methodologies.

The Calculation Formula
Our engine uses a multi-variable bidirectional formula:
- Traditional Cost (TC): $TC = (L \times BR \times C \times R) + SF$. Where L is length, BR is base rate per second, C is complexity, R is regional multiplier, and SF is fixed studio/equipment fees.
- AI Cost (AC): $AC = (L \times TR \times C) + (H \times PR)$. Where TR is the token/generation rate, and PR is the prompt engineer's hourly rate for refining outputs.
Importance of These Calculations
Why bother with such a detailed comparison? Because the efficiency gap is widening. Traditional production involves linear costs: more footage requires more shoot days, more catering, and more physical storage. AI production involves non-linear costs: the initial "training" or "prompting" phase is expensive in terms of time, but the marginal cost of producing an extra 30 seconds of video is nearly zero. This calculator helps businesses identify the "Break-even Point" where AI becomes the fiscally responsible choice.
Related Tips for Production Scaling
If you are looking to scale your content, consider a hybrid approach. Use traditional production for "Hero" content (high-stakes brand films) and leverage AI for localized variations, social media snippets, and A/B testing variations. This maximizes ROI by keeping the soul of the production human-led while using AI to handle the volume.
